Background: From 1991 to the Present Bank failure resolution policies and procedures have evolved significantly in Argentina since the introduction of Convertibility in 1991. This evolution has reflected a remarkable ability quickly to adapt -within the constraints imposed by Convertibility Law- the legal, normative, organizational, and procedural frameworks to deal with bank failures in the midst of the stress caused by two adverse exogenous shocks: the major Tequila shock of 1995 and the relatively more benign financial turbulence unleashed * Lead Specialist, Finance, Latin American and the Caribbean Region, The World Bank. The author wishes to acknowledge the useful comments provided by Stefan Alber, Aquiles Almansi, Federico Caparros-Bosch, Gerard Caprio, Asli Demirguc-Kunt, Jonathan Fiechter, Paul Levy, and Marjory Waxman. The normal disclaimers apply. 2 since the second half of 1997 by the South East Asian and Russian crises. In adapting the bank failure resolution, the authorities have sought to strike an appropriate balance between two objectives: averting contagion and limiting moral hazard. In 1991, at the beginning of the Convertibility Plan, Argentina had a bare-bones system of bank failure resolution: troubled banks unable to restore compliance with key prudential norms, particularly those associated with solvency and/or liquidity, would automatically see their license removed and go on to judicial liquidation.' Under such system -not unlike those existing in many Latin American countries- there was neither an explicit deposit insurance scheme nor resolution procedures other than judicial liquidation, implying that, in the event of a bank failure, all deposits would immediately turn Illiquid and value-Impaired. Depositors would have to wait in line for a long time (months and even years) to have access to liquidation proceeds. Given the protracted, legally assailable, and cumbersome nature of the judicial liquidation process, a sharp destruction of asset value would take place compared to their going concern value. Under these circumstances, depositors derived little consolation, if at all, from their relatively high position in the priority of claims ladder -just below labor claims. By featuring a clear risk of loss to depositors, this bare-bones system of bank resolution sought to minimize moral hazard -an objective that was gladly embraced in reaction to the huge Central Bank losses and runaway inflation that had resulted from previous episodes of banking crises and bailouts. The system aimed at encouraging depositors to monitor the condition of banks and impose discipline on them, not only by asking for higher interest rates when depositing in banks perceived to be riskier but also by precipitating, through a run on deposits, the closure of banks perceived to be unviable. But it was soon observed that a resolution framework purely consisting of judicial liquidation was Intensifying deposit runs, dangerously magnifying the erosion of confidence and propagating distress. Under such circumstances, the authorities introduced in the first half of 1995 three important Institutional Innovations directly relevant to bank failure resolution. Two of these innovations -the reforms to the Financial Institutions Law and the creation of a Deposit Guarantee Scheme- were meant to be permanent, i.e., to endure beyond the Tequila juncture. The third, consisting of the creation of a Bank Capitalization Trust Fund, was seen as a transitional crisis management tool, although its two-year life was subsequently extended until February 2000. As regards the first innovation, the core reform of the Financial -Institutions Law (No. 21.526) introduced in 1995 is embodied in Article 35 bis. This article empowers the Central Bank to carry out a version of a "good bank/bad bank" resolution procedure before the liquidation of a falling bank. This procedure consists of: (i) separating from the liability side of the failing bank the privileged liabilities, namely, liabilities to labor, deposits, and debts to the Central Bank; (ii) carving out assets from the asset side; and (ii) transferring the assets and liabilities thus separated to another existing financial institution, ensuring "equivalence" between the transferred assets and deposits. The procedure can be applied, at the sole discretion of the Central Bank, to a bank deemed to be unviable and prior to the removal of its license,3 with the result that only the residual or "bad" bank (containing the assets and liabilities that were not separated and transferred) would go on to judicial liquidation. - This type of good bank/bad bank surgery is underpinned by a priority of claims queue for unsecured claims, according to which employees stand ahead of depositors, (and internationally traded) bonds Issued by the Republic of Argentina, provided that such bonds do not exceed one third of total disposable reserves. 3 A bank may be deemed unviable, and thus subject to the revocation of its license when, in the sole* opinion of the Central Bank, Its solvency and/or liquidity position is so weak that it cannot be restored to health via a rehabilitation plan (see Article 44 of Law No. 21.526). 4 depositors before the Central Bank, and the Central Bank ahead of other claims on the failing bank. There is no room for bailing out bank shareholders under Article 35 bis; shareholders are always left in the residual bank. Additionally, the Central Bank is given in the Law what appears to be ample authority to eliminate or substantially dilute the property rights of shareholders, including by writing down their capital against identified losses and required increases in provisions, or by revoking their right to be in the banking business, even prior to the application of Article 35 bis. Article 35 bis would seem to imply that claims with priority lower than that of the Central Bank must always stay in the residual ("bad") bank and await the results of the liquidation. As a consequence, the good bank/bad bank separation provided for under this Article must normally be performed with the bank closed; for if it were open, non- depositor creditors would engineer a run to avoid the losses associated with being relegated to the residual bank. The second institutional innovation consisted In the creation of a Deposit Guarantee Scheme (Sistema de Seguro de Garantia de los Dep6sitos Bancarios) via Law No. 24.485. This scheme is composed of a Fondo de Garantia de Dep6sitos (FGD) and a corporation, the Seguro de Dep6sitos Sociedad An6nima (SEDESA), which administers the FDG. SEDESA offers a guarantee, per depositor, of up to US$30,000, provided that the interest rate paid on such deposits does not exceed a certain level.5 The FGD is fed by mandatory contributions paid by the banking industry. The Central Bank has flexibility in setting the rate of contribution within a range -from a minimum of 0.015 percent to a maximum of 0.06 percent of average daily deposits- and may require the advanced payment of up to two years of contributions. The Investment and uses of the FGD are governed by an Executive Committee made up by representatives from the contributing financial institutions; the Central Bank has one representative in such Committee, who lacks voting power but has veto power. After this period, the license of the failing bank is removed and judicial liquidation of the residual ("bad") bank begins. s Not covered by the guarantee are also related-party deposits and deposits made by other financial institutions. 5 In the event of a bank failure, SEDESA could use FGD resources to pay guaranteed deposits in cash, in which case it has the special right to get payments from the liquidation before all non-guaranteed depositors. However, SEDESA is not confined to the cash payout option when honoring the deposit guarantee. The Executive Committee may also authorize the use of FGD resources to inject capital into, or make a loan, including a non-reimbursable one, to: (i) a financial institution under a rehabilitation plan; (ii) a financial Institution that purchases the assets and assumes the deposits of a bank that is under the Article 35 bis procedure; or (iii) a financial institution that buys a bank that is under a rehabilitation plan. Any of these three operations may be authorized if, in doing so, the direct cost to the FGD is lower than what it would be if the cash payout route were followed. Clearly, the second of these three alternatives to a cash payout of guaranteed deposits has the potential of enhancing significantly the flexibility of the good bank/bad bank resolution procedure contemplated in Article 35 bis -a flexibility that has been often seized by the authorities. The third innovation introduced in the first half of 1995 was the creation, by Decree 445/95, of a Bank Capitalization Trust Fund (Fondo Fiduciario de Capitalizaci6n Bancaria). This Trust Fund has been fed mainly by budgetary transfers financed via a special bond issue (the Bono Argentina 1998) as well as the proceeds from loans granted by multilateral organizations, including, importantly, by the World Bank under the 1995 Argentina Bank Reform Loan. The Trust Fund was designed to strengthen the hand of the authorities in dealing with the banking system turmoil created by the Tequila. According to the decree, the Trust Fund is empowered to inject capital into financial institutions directly, Including by making loans convertible into equity, or indirectly, by buying the illiquid assets of distressed financial entities. In practice, the Trust Fund has utilized only two instruments in assisting financial institutions: a long term collateralized loan; and a noncollateralized subordinated loan, convertible into a negotiable obligation. The authorities have used the Trust Fund to foster consolidation in the banking system, via assisted bank mergers, acquisitions, and capitalization.6 Where these transactions turned out to be nonviable, the Trust Fund has absorbed 6 With the assistance of the Bank Capitalization Trust Fund, 19 transactions involving private sector financial institutions have been performed. The Trust Fund has provided some US$750 million in loans, of which only US$89 million have been definitively lost in transactions that turned out to be nonviable. At present, the Trust Fund is no longer active and virtually has no funds. 6 losses, thereby facilitating the construction of the "good" bank under Article 35 bis procedures. Taken jointly, the three institutional innovations mentioned above contributed significantly to preventing what could have otherwise been a banking system meltdown unleashed by the Tequila. The increase in moral hazard that may have resulted from the bailout of large depositors that these innovations afforded in some cases, can be rightly considered to have been a small price paid in order to limit contagion risk under the turbulent financial environment unleashed by the Tequila. Moreover, a systemic crises was avoided with very little use of public sector resources, particularly when compared to international experiences. In part due to these institutional innovations, since 1995 the authorities have broadly succeeded in promoting an orderly process of consolidation and strengthening of the banking system,'7 with striking results.8 In the period July 1995 to December 1998 the Argentine authorities resolved 16 financial Intermediaries using the powers under Article 35 bis. The liabilities of the resolved institutions added to more than US$4.3 billion, with the median size bank in the group (Banco Argencoop) featuring liabilities of around US$210 million, and the largest case having been that of Banco Mayo, with liabilities of some US$1.3 billion. In 10 of these 16 cases, FGD resources were used to facilitate the execution of Article 35 bis procedure -essentially by completing the asset side of the "good" bank- for a sum total of around US$600 million. The Capitalization Trust Fund provided, to the same end, a total of around US$325 million, which were distributed over 8 cases. The resolution processes under Article 35 bis, while representing a dramatic improvement over the judicial liquidation alternative, often proved to be protracted. The recent case of Banco Almafuerte may be seen as an illustration that bank failure resolution in Argentina has come of age. However, the same case puts into sharp focus a number of issues that need careful assessment. 2. The Emerging New Model of Bank Resolution-the case of Banco Almafuerte Banco Almafuerte Coop. Ltdo. was a small bank by Argentine standards, with a book value of assets of about US$200 million. Its failure was effectively resolved over a weekend, a major achievement even after considering that It was the case of a small bank, for It stands in sharp contrast with almost all prior cases that took weeks or months. This is all the more impressive considering that -as was mentioned earlier- the resolution-procedure of Article 35 bis can be performed realistically only with the failing bank's doors closed. A long period of closed doors Is bound to cause not only severe irritation among the bank's creditors but also a deterioration in the value of its assets. Under unsettled financial markets, furthermore, delays in executing the Article 35 bis procedure could also lead to contagious deposit runs. In the case of Almafuerte, these problems were avoided, as its doors were for only a couple days and during a time (a weekend) when they would have been closed anyhow. In resolving Almafuerte, the Central Bank authorities combined Innovative financial engineering with the full range of powers under Article 35 bis, as well as with the powers granted to the Executive Committee of the FGD. Annex 1 presents a simplified numerical example of a bank resolution based on the approach used in the case of Almafuerte. The example -whose numbers bear no resemblance to the actual case- should help the reader visualize more clearly the description of Almafuerte's resolution provided below. A main source of delays In executing the good bank/bad bank surgery contemplated in Article 35 bis has been the time required for due dilligence In order reasonably to estimate the value of assets. In the case of Almafuerte, this hurdle was overcome by a form of asset securitization, that is, by placing the assets (other than cash) of Almafuerte into a Trust (Fideicomiso) that, in turn, issued bonds backed by those assets. 8 The Trust issued three classes of bonds: A, B, and C. Bonds type A were structured to be senior to B, and B Bonds senior to C Bonds. That is, in the event of a shortage of resources in the Trust, B Bonds would be serviced only if there are resources left over after servicing A Bonds, with C Bonds standing a similar relation of subordination relative to B Bonds. To reduce the probability of default, particularly with respect to A Bonds, the book value of assets placed in the Trust was substantially higher than the total face value of bonds it issued (a ratio of assets to bonds of about 1.50 to 1.00). This version of asset securitization permitted a quick construction of the "good" bank. In effect, 8 good banks were assembled during Almafuerte's resolution, because there were 8 existing financial Institutions that participated in acquiring the assets and assuming the deposits of such "good" banks. The "good" banks were put together in line with the geograplc distribution of the Almafuerte's branch network. Each "good" bank contained, In the liability side, the debts to labor and the deposits corresponding to the branches In a given geographic area and, in the asset side, three assets: cash, A Bonds, and an IOU from SEDESA for an amount up to the corresponding guaranteed deposits.9 There were, consequently, as many Trusts containing Almafuerte's assets as "good" banks. As required by Article 35 bis, the asset and liability sides of each "good" bank were matched, Implying a zero accounting net worth, with the amount of the IOU from SEDESA essentially set as a residual to ensure that assets match liabilities. Each "good" bank was transferred "as is" to the acquirer, who did not make any explicit payment in respect of the franchise value of the "good" bank. This in part reflected the concerted nature of the operation, with the Central Bank playing a major coordinating role. Each acquirer bank took on, for a fee, the responsibility of managing, recovering, or selling the assets in the corresponding Trust. Central Bank claims on Almafuerte, resulting from the liquidity assistance it had provided to that bank before its failure, were not part of the liability side of the "good" banks, nor did they stay in the residual ("bad") bank, in the sense that the Central Bank did not go as a creditor into the liquidation phase. Instead, the Central Bank ceded to the Trust the assets It had received as collateral to the mentioned liquidity assistance and, in exchange, received B Bonds, thereby standing as the second claimant in line vis- 9 SEDESA contributed an IOU (backed by future FGD receivables), rather than cash, because the FGD's liquid funds had been fully drained in previous cases of bank failures. 9 A-vis the Trust. This treatment of Central Bank liquidity credits can be construed to be consistent with the priority of claims rules specified in Articles 49 and 53 of Financial Institutions Law (No. 21.526) for judicial liquidation. Similarly, the claims of SEDESA on Almafuerte's assets -resulting from the addition of a SEDESA IOU to the "good" bank- did not form part of the liability side of the "good" bank nor did it integrate the residual bank. Instead, SEDESA received C Bonds, thereby standing third in the queue vis-h-vis the Trust. This treatment of SEDESA can be construed to be consistent with the privileges it has under the Law only to the extent that SEDESA has better chances of recovering its resources by standing third in line vis- h-vis the Trust than by standing ahead of non-guaranteed deposits vis-h-vis the judicial liquidation. That this may be possible can be rather surprising for a non-Latin American observer. However, the truth is that in Argentina, as in most of Latin America, the liquidation process -whether judicial or extra-judicial- tends to be staggeringly inefficient, generally implying an excessive destruction of asset value. The resolution of Almafuerte minimized the size of the residual ("bad") bank that would go on to judicial liquidation. In the liability side, the residual bank contained only non-privileged liabilities, i.e., Almafuerte's liabilities left after excluding those to labor, depositors, the Central Bank, and SEDESA. In the asset side, the residual bank included only the assets that the Trusts would put back -assets deemed to be non-recoverable or without value. 3. The Emerging Model of Bank Failure Resolution-Issues for Discussion The resolution structure applied in the case of Banco Almafuerte was, undoubtedly, skillfully executed. The securitization of assets achieved by the Trust arrangement was innovative and effective, in that it facilitated the quick transfer of the "good" bank. In turn, the speedy nature of the operation substantially reduced the depositor uncertainty and distress often associated with bank closures, thereby minimizing contagion risk. It may be also argued that this type of rapid, nondestabilizing resolution of troubled banks has had and will continue to have a positive feedback on banking discipline. Quick, effective bank resolution removes concerns that supervisory authorities may have about the systemic implications of closing a bank and, thus, is likely to foster tougher 10 enforcement and earlier intervention and resolution of unviable banks. Moreover, the authorities' current effort to standardize contracts and procedures involving the Trust scheme, should further enhance the resolution process. However, as the authorities undertake a systematic review of bank failure resolution, a number of general as well as Argentine-specific issues arise, pointing towards areas where improvements may be considered. 3.1. The "all-deposits" constraint Important issues revolve around the fact that Article 35 bis contains a crucial constraint that increases moral hazard (while reducing contagion risk) and tends to deplete rapidly the liquid resources of the FGD. Article 35 bis requires the incorporation of all the deposits, regardless of their size, in the liability side of the "good" bank -a constraint that henceforth will be referred to as the "all-deposits constraint." Sufficient assets must be found to match the total amount of deposits, otherwise Article 35 bis cannot be applied and the resolution defaults to judicial liquidation. This constraint thus implies that the FGD's liquid resources would tend to be drained quickly in the resolution of a middle-size or large bank -as the recent experience with the case of Banco Mayo has shown. In effect, according to the current legislation, if the value of non-cash assets under judicial liquidation approaches zero, in each resolution SEDESA could contribute to the asset side of the "good" bank up to an amount equal to the failing bank's guaranteed deposits, with the maximum contribution tending to be required in most resolution cases in order to match all the deposits of the failing bank. With cash (or IOUs) from SEDESA used to complete the required amount of assets in the "good" bank, what was intended to be a limited deposit guarantee becomes de facto a full deposit guarantee, with the FGD standing to loose ahead of large depositors. (Recall in this connection that SEDESA gets C bonds, compared to depositors whose resources are backed by A Bonds.) Annex 1 depicts this type of situation, illustrating also that a maximum contribution from SEDESA to the "good" bank may be required even in cases where the failing bank's insolvency is not particularly deep -equivalent to 10 percent of total liabilities in the Annex's example. There are, of course, ways to relax the all-deposits constraint and to control better the contribution of the Deposit Guarantee Agency to the asset side of the good bank. Given 11 the trade-off between moral hazard and contagion risk, it would be presumptuous and plain wrong to think that a simple recipe for a "right" balance exists. However, in assessing possible changes and refinements to their bank failure resolution system, the Argentine authorities may wish to review the range of feasible policy choices and issues along the lines of the paragraphs below. 3.2. Criteria to construct the liability side of the "good" bank Key issues concern the procedures and criteria used to construct the asset and liability sides of the "good" bank during the resolution phase. As regards the liability side of the "good" bank, the all-deposits constraint reflects a well-known legal tradition whereby different classes of creditors have different priorities of claim via-h-vis available assets, but there are no priority of claim differences within a given class of creditors. Accordingly, depositors as a class of creditors have a priority of claim over, say, subordinated debt holders but individual depositors are treated alike, sharing pro-rata in the pool of available assets. An explicit, limited deposit insurance scheme alters this scheme somewhat, as it gives guaranteed deposits a privilege over the non-guaranteed ones in the event of a bank failure. The logic of these priority of claims rules, together with a limited deposit guarantee scheme, leads to the conclusion that a "good" bank may be constructed in the resolution phase if it contains, in the liability side, either all deposits or only guaranteed deposits, with no choices in between. To escape these corner solutions, a rule would be needed to establish a priority of claim sequence among depositors, effectively revising the pro-rata criterion. A natural candidate that would give maximum flexibility would be an incremental rule, according to which the limit per depositor to be included in the "good" bank would be decided at the discretion of the resolution authorities. The authorities would have the freedom to raise such limit gradually, starting from the guaranteed amount, up to the point where the amount per depositor is such that liability side of the "good" bank is no greater than its asset side. The examples provided in Annexes 2 and 3 use this incremental rule in constructing the "good" bank; however, as deposit amounts cannot be shown along a continuum, they are shown in tranches (e.g., more than $30,000 but less or equal to $50,000, etc.). 12 This incremental rule would mitigate moral hazard by giving operational meaning to the notion that smaller depositors should have a priority of claim over larger ones. The risk of loss In the event of a bank failure for large depositors would give them an incentive to monitor the condition of banks. With appropriate legal drafting, the application of the incremental rule could be circumscribed to the resolution phase, leaving the application of the traditional pro-rata criterion for deposits left in the residual ("bad") bank that moves on to liquidation. The Argentine authorities have recently proposed to Congress certain legal reforms, including a rule that would relax the all-deposits constraint of Article 38 bis, by permitting the non-inclusion of amounts above $100,000 per depositor in the "good" bank. More precisely, under the reformed legislation, the liability side of the "good" bank would always have to incorporate at least deposit amounts up to US$100,000. But it there is an excess of assets in the "good" bank, deposit amounts above that figure could be also included on a pro-rata, rather than an incremental, basis. The authorities may wish to consider the merits of revising the proposed legal amendment in order to accommodate the full flexibility and operational simplicity of an incremental rule. Another issue in the construction of the liability side of the "good" bank concerns the definition of eligible deposits. Such a definition would imply that there are certain types of deposits that would in no case be included in the "good" bank; they would have to remain always in the residual bank. The simplest way to tackle this issue would be by following the same logic used in defining insured deposits (see page 4 above, including footnote 5), with the result that related-party deposits, deposits by other financial institutions, and deposits whose interest rate exceed certain level would all be ineligible -i.e., they would be condemned to stay in the residual bank In the event of a bank failure. In the absence of a clear delimitation of eligible deposits, interbank deposits related to the subordinated debt scheme (i.e., the "B" of the BASIC program) could end- up in the "good" bank, balled-out at the expense of FGD resources. An unambiguous definition of eligible deposits that would be relevant to the application of Article 35 bis would undoubtedly enhance bank monitoring and limit moral hazard. It may, however, pose certain operational complications that could hamper somewhat the speed of bank failure resolution. 13 3.3. Criteria to construct the asset side of the "good" bank The key issue in assembling the asset side of the "good" bank concerns the determination of whether the Deposit Guarantee Agency should make a contribution and the size of It. Following are the main options and issues in this regard. An option that would maximize protection to the resources of the Deposit Guarantee Agency (DGA) and, hence, minimize moral hazard, would be to define the deposit guarantee as conditional on asset Insufficiency, implying that the DGA would make a contribution to the assets of the "good" bank only if there are not enough assets in the failing bank to cover guaranteed deposits. The DGA conditional contribution, if triggered, would be for an amount no greater than what is needed to honor the deposit guarantee. To further protect Its resources, the DGA could be given a first-in-line claim In the liquidation of the residual bank.10 And to enhance the effectiveness of bank failure resolution process, the incremental rule mentioned above could be used for the determination of the liability side of the "good" bank. A deposit guarantee conditional on asset Insufficiency implies that non-guaranteed deposits would not benefit at the expense of the DGA and that bank failures would not drain systematically the DGA's liquid resources. The trade-off is, of course, that such guarantee is relatively less effective in the management of systemic stress, as it provides relatively less flexibility to control contagion risk. Annex 2 provides a simplified example of a bank failure resolution under a regime that combines a deposit guarantee conditional on asset insufficiency, on the one hand, and an incremental rule, on the other. The example illustrates that, under that regime, the DGA would tend not to be exposed to a risk of loss even in the case of a resolution of a deeply insolvent bank (the bank in the example has an insolvency "hole" equivalent to 50 percent of total liabilities), and even if asset value declines significantly under the liquidation phase (in the example, non-cash assets loose 60 percent of their value as a result of moving on to liquidation), but provided that guaranteed deposits amounts are not too high. 10 This alternative could be relaxed without undermining its spirit by allowing the DGA to advance liquid resources to facilitate the resolution process, provided that within a certain period (and in any case prior to the liquidation of the residual bank) the DGA recovers in full such resources. 14 An the other extreme from the previous option would be a full DGA's contribution, meaning that the DGA would always inject resources in the asset side of the "good" bank in an amount equal to the guaranteed deposits of the failing bank, independently of the value of available asset in this bank. In exchange, the DGA would stand as a creditor in the liquidation of the residual ("bad") bank. Under this regime, an incremental rule would be useful only in case the "good" bank could not accommodate all the deposits of the failing bank, even after the contribution from the DGA. The example in Annex 1 has been constructed to illustrate this regime. A good bank/bank bank procedure based on a full contribution by the DGA to the "good" bank would provide flexibility to protect all deposits in most cases, thereby reducing the trauma of a bank closure and minimizing the risk of contagious runs on other banks. This flexibility would be valuable particularly in the management of systemic stress, e.g., In the context of a simultaneous or sequential failure of several banks. The trade-off is, of course, the increase in moral hazard because large depositors would get bailed out at the expense of DGA's loss." A corollary disadvantage is that bank failure resolution would systematically and substantially drain the liquid resources of the DGA. Hence, the more bank failure resolution approaches this polar alternative, the greater would be the need for substantial backstop financing for the DGA.12 3.4. The "least cost" criterion and Its Implications Between the two extremes mentioned above, there are a continuum of alternatives where the contribution of the DGA to the "good" bank is controlled through some form of a least cost criterion. For the purposes of this note, the standard definition of this criterion implies that a good bank/bad bank type resolution should be implemented only if it imposes a cost to the DGA that Is no greater that the cost that the DGA would incur if it were to pay out guaranteed deposits in cash, in exchange for a fairly privileged claim on the liquidation. Four variables affect the potential size of the DGA st Moral hazard could be offset In some degree, however, through tight supervision and, particularly, early intervention and resolution. Early resolution takes away from the shareholders and administrators of an insolvent bank the "captive" depositor funds, thus depriving them of the wherewithal with which they could take on excessive risks or loot. 12 Under Argentine-type convertibility, backstop financing to a DGA could not entail money creation by the Central Bank; it would have to come from domestic or, preferably, external debt. 15 contribution to the "good" bank under a least cost criterion: (i) the size of the insolvency "hole" of the failing bank -caeteris paribus, the greater the insolvency the greater the potential contribution by the DGA; (ii) the priority of claim accorded the DGA in the liquidation -the higher such priority, the smaller the potential contribution by the DGA; (iii) the share of guaranteed deposits in the liabilities of the failing bank -the higher such share, the higher the potential contribution by the DGA; and (iv) the degree of loss in the value of assets as they move into judicial liquidation -the greater the loss, the larger the potential contribution by the DGA. Rather than examining in detail the effects of the various combinations of these four variables on the contribution by the DGA to the "good" bank, it appears preferable to lay out two sets of general observations that are helpful In clarifying the policy options. First, only benefits can be obtained from Improving and enforcing prompt corrective action and early Intervention rules, in order to minimize the probability that insolvent banks continue to operate, which would strengthen the soundness of the banking system. Similarly, major benefits could be obtained from streamlining the liquidation process, as this would imply a lesser loss of value for assets under liquidation and, thus, a lower risk of loss for the DGA under a least cost criterion. Regardless of whether the DGA stands first in line or not vis-h-vis the liquidation, and notwithstanding the importance of minimizing the size of the residual bank for effective resolution, the least cost criterion would yield a high cost to the DGA If asset value collapses in the liquidation phase. The foregoing considerations suggest that, in reviewing bank failure resolution, the Argentine authorities would do well in casting a wide net, so as to identify improvements to the antecessor phase (prompt correction and early intervention) and successor phase (liquidation) of bank resolution proper. The World Bank could assist the Argentine authorities by providing references of international best practices in connection with these areas. Second, given the way in which least cost is calculated, the DGA's priority of claim in the liquidation makes a significant difference in Its exposure to risk of loss. The good bank/bad bank resolution examples in Annex 3 illustrate the two alternatives for the DGA's priority ranking vis-h-vis the liquidation, namely, for the DGA to be (I) in the same situation as non-guaranteed depositors, sharing with them on a pro-rata basis," 13 This alternative is featured in the United States Federal Deposit Insurance system. 16 or (ii) first in line, i.e., ahead on non-guaranteed depositors. Sharing pro-rata with non- guaranteed depositors in the liquidation necessarily entails that the DGA offers some protection to these depositors. The way this plays out In a good bank/bad bank resolution procedure is that the least cost calculation leads to a significant contribution by the DGA to the asset side of the "good" bank, as is Illustrated by the example in Alternative A of Annex 3. In contrast, a first-in-line priority of claim in the liquidation severely reduces the DGA's exposure to risk of loss, even if the failing bank is deeply insolvent and the loss of asset value under the liquidation phase is substantial. This is Illustrated by the example in alternative B of Annex 3, where the least cost calculation leads to no losses for the DGA in a resolution of a failing bank that has an insolvency "hole" equivalent to 40 percent of liabilities and whose non-cash assets loose 60 percent of their value by virtue of entering the liquidation stage. Again, by moving from the first to the second alternative In Annex 3, flexibility to control contagion risk is sacrificed for the sake of reduced moral hazard. 3.5. The asset-liability equivalence constraint Article 35 bis explicitly requires that "equivalence" be maintained between the assets and liabilities that are separated from the failing bank and then transferred. While it is not clear why such equivalence is called for in the Law, one can certainly think of cases where the constraint would unnecessarily hinder maximum asset value preservation and recovery. Assume the failure of a bank where the value of "good" assets significantly exceeds deposits. The equivalence constraint would force us to leave "good" assets in the residual bank, with social costs resulting from the loss of value of such assets under liquidation. Clearly, non-depositor creditors would be better off and depositors would not be worse off if: (i) a "good" bank containing an excess of assets over deposits were constructed and transferred; and (ii) the proceeds from such transfer (net of transactions costs) would be placed -as they should- in favor of the liquidation. 3.6. Institutional arrangements The effectiveness of bank failure resolution is not independent of the organizational and institutional arrangements that house it. This raises the general issue of whether the responsibility for bank resolution should rest with an independent, specialized institution, 17 separate from the banking supervision agency. A number of incentives-related reasons appear to militate in favor of a separate entity which, in practice, has tended to be a publicly administered Deposit Guarantee Agency -such is the case, for instance, of the United States FDIC and Spanish FOGADE. It may be argued that a separate deposit guarantee/resolution agency would have (i) a natural incentive to protect the integrity of the accumulated guarantee fund; (ii) no psychological resistance for early intervention and resolution of a failing bank, as opposed to bank supervisors who may tend to perceive their role as one of preventing bank closures, possibly even interpreting those closures as an admission of supervisory failure; and (iii) specialized skills in bank failure resolution, skills that are quite different than those required for bank supervision. Furthermore, it would seem that involving the Central Bank too deeply in bank failure resolution processes could damage the credibility of monetary and bank supervision policies. These arguments have to be weighed against important reasons, particularly practical ones, that can be advanced in favor or keeping bank failure resolution powers with the supervisory agency. There is, in the case of Argentina, the credibility that that the Central Bank brings to the application of Article 35 bis, on account of its recognized independence and proven professionalism. More generally, there are likely to be coordination gains and economies of scale (particularly where skilled human resources are in shortage and substantial learning by doing has already been accumulated) in having the supervisory and resolution functions under the same roof. Be it as It may, the issue of organizational and institutional arrangements is of great importance and should be included in the comprehensive review of bank failure resolution that the Argentine authorities plan to undertake. 3.7. Legal protection Resolving and closing a failed bank are extreme expressions of "enforcement" which, if delayed, gives rise to high social costs. Hence, the prompt and effective execution of resolution procedures requires solid legal ground as well as clear legal protection for the bank failure resolution process Itself (lawsuits should not suspend It) and for the authorities charged with the responsibility. Authorities need to be protected against lawsuits initiated against them for actions carried out in good faith in the performance of 18 their official duties; otherwise they would fall to act forcibly and in a timely manner. Such protection, which is consistent with the first of the Basle Core Principles for Effective Bank Supervision, is unfortunately weak in most Latin American countries, including Argentina. Rules versus discretion A deeper, general issue that permeates most of the discussion in this section is that of rules versus discretion. Bank failure resolution is an complex subject where sound judgement is essential, which argues for a degree of discretion. Too much discretion, however, contributes to lack of transparency and erodes accountability. The "right" balance is of course elusive, not the least because even in a rules-intensive system aimed a minimizing moral, the too-big-to-fail phenomenon would tend to undermine the viability -and hence the credibility- of such tight rules. These complications notwithstanding, the Argentine authorities may wish to explore this issue in their review of bank failure resolution processes, by weighing the pros and cons of the two prototypical approaches briefly described below. The first approach emphasizes the option value of discretion. As a consequence, it has a bias in favor of a bank resolution framework that would leave considerable flexibility to control contagion risk. This may be accomplished by, say, allowing for the inclusion of all deposits and even certain non-deposit liabilities in the liability side of the "good" bank and defining the size of the contribution of the DGA to the asset side of the "good" bank independently of the value of available assets of the failing bank. To limit the attendant moral hazard, however, this approach practices "constructive ambiguity," by maintaining alive the threat of not carrying out the Article 35 bis-type procedure and, thus, allocating losses to non-guaranteed deposits through traditional liquidation, in the event of a bank failure. The second approach, by contrast, emphasizes the virtues of rules. As a consequence, it favors a bank failure resolution framework that minimizes moral hazard and the risk of 19 loss to the DGA. This can be done by, say, defining the deposit guarantee as conditional on asset insufficiency and according the DGA a first-in-line priority of claim in the liquidation. However, conscious of the too-big-to-fail phenomena and the need to control contagion risk under extreme circumstances, this approach provides for a "rule" that would permit the abandonment of "normal rules." This extraordinary rule could take the form of a contingent clause In the Law that specifies the conditions under which, when systemic risk is perceived by the relevant authorities, the deposit* guarantee limit can be, by exception, raised to cover up to all deposits and, if needed, even up to all bank liabilities. 14 3.9. Other issues Finally, some more specific issues are worth mentioning. The first concerns the current lack of liquid resources In the DGF managed by SEDESA. These funds were depleted with the resolution of Banco Mayo; moreover, as a result of the most recent resolutions, several months of the Fund's future receivables have already been mortgaged. Such lack of liquid resources erodes the credibility of the Deposit Guarantee and hinders the effectiveness of bank failure resolution processes. In this connection, the Argentine authorities may wish to analyze the convenience and/or feasibility of backstop financing for SEDESA. Given the constraints Imposed by Convertibility, an appropriate backstop financing could take the form of a contingent line of external credit to SEDESA, provided by multilateral sources or private capital markets. However, as was noted before, the size of possible backstop financing cannot be determined independently of the criteria and procedures that guide the construction the "good" bank. Second, the Argentine authorities may wish to assess the utility and appropriateness of including additional mechanisms to the bank failure resolution toolkit. In particular, they could consider the figure of a "bridge bank" as featured, for instance, in the United States FDIC Improvement Act of 1991. A bridge bank is a temporary license for the operation of a "good" bank, which may come in handy where, say, the resolution 14 This second approach was adopted in United States by the FDIC Improvement Act of 1991. It introduced a contingent clause according to which, when handling a failing bank, the FDIC can extend coverage to bank liabilities beyond the insured amount if there is a joint determination by the Board of Governors of the Federal Reserve, the FDIC Board, and the Treasury Secretary (after consulting with the President of the United States) that the failure of such bank would entail systemic risk. 20 must be completed quickly to avoid confidence erosion but time is still needed to achieve a successful sale of the "good" bank. Additionally, the Argentine authorities could consider suitable normative amendments to widen the arsenal of contractual arrangements that can facilitate the transfer of a "good" bank's assets -for instance, "loss-sharing" agreements that may improve the buyer's incentives to maximize asset recovery. The review of these alternatives could prove even more useful considering that the Trust scheme used in the case of Banco Almafuerte appears to lack adequate Incentives to promote maximum asset recovery.15 Third, the particular financial engineering utilized in the resolution of Banco Almafuerte raises Issues in connection to the potential payment failure by the Trust and the treatment of A Bonds for regulatory purposes. To be sure, the overcollateralization of the Bonds issued by the Trust clearly reduces the risk of default by the latter, particularly In respect of the (senior) A Bonds. Nonetheless, It seems reasonable to argue that there is a nonzero probability of nonpayment. Recognizing this, the Central Bank recently has created a contingent fund that would make payments on A Bonds in case the corresponding Trust were unable to do so. This fund is the result of a "controlled" regulatory forbearance scheme, according to which the banks that acquire "good" banks (in the context of the application of Article 35 bis) are allowed to constitute part of the regulatory minimum liquidity with public bonds that yield a greater interest rate than that earned on deposits in the Central Bank; the earnings attributable to such difference in rates feed the mentioned fund. Given this scheme, the Central Bank allows for A Bonds to be recorded in the balance sheets at face value, without the need for provisions. 'Ingenious though it is, the scheme does reduce systemic liquidity, insignificantly at this stage, but it could do It in a noticeable manner in the event of a failure of a large bank or of several small to mid-size ones.
